Lampedusa 51 migrants, 10 dead. And in Calabria 64 missing and 1 dead

More death in the central Mediterranean, off the coast of Lampedusa. Ten corpses were found in the belly of a wooden boat, migrants perhaps suffocated and killed by fuel fumes. Overall, there were 61 people on board – explains the NGO Resqship -: 51 were taken away, two of them unconscious while another 10 were found lifeless in the lower part of the hull. The team also intervened with an ax to access the inside of the boat. Resqship’s Nadir sailing ship was over 100 miles from the Libyan coast, in international waters just over 40 miles from Lampedusa, near the Maltese SAR area.

German NGO: “We are angry and sad”

The day before he had received a report relating to another boat in danger, launched by Alarm Phone: there were 62 people on board who were then entrusted to the coast guard. Nadir therefore continued to monitor the sea until the tragic discovery of the vessel with the 10 dead. The 51 survivors underwent first aid on the sailing ship awaiting their urgently requested medical evacuation. “Our thoughts are with the victims and mourners. We are angry and sad. ‘Fortress Europe’ kills.” This is the accusation of the German NGO.

The landings in Lampedusa continue

A body was also on another boat, together with the twelve migrants rescued by the coast guard 120 miles from the coast and taken to Roccella Jonica, but they are feared missing. Just as the landings in Lampedusa continue: 173 migrants arrived during the night on three boats. The financial police and coast guard patrol boats came to their aid. On the first, there were 103 people, including 3 minors, of Bangladeshi, Sudanese, Syrian and Egyptian nationality. They told the rescuers that they had left from the port of Zawia, in Libya.

Migrant boat capsizes off the coast of Calabria, 50 missing and 1 dead

About sixty migrants are missing due to the capsizing of the sailing boat on which they were travelling, about one hundred miles from the coast of Calabria. A merchant vessel came to the rescue of the vessel and subsequently transferred the 12 surviving migrants to a Coast Guard unit which then landed in Roccella Ionica. The body of a woman who died after falling into the sea also arrived in port. The search for the missing people has now been activated, but, at the moment, none have been recovered.
